Overview

Nestled in Bridgewater’s Woodland Gardens Park, the museum houses Canada’s fifth-oldest history collection, started by Judge M. B. DesBrisay in 1870. Come see the world-famous 1868 porcupine quill cradle. Check out our historic photographs and ship models that will take you back to the early 19th century. Marvel at the colourful folk art, take in the Bridgewater Photo Club corridor, and experience our rotating gallery that changes monthly.

Pick up a souvenir from our gift shop, which has locally made artisan works and books on the history of Lunenburg County.

Families can be history detectives. Researchers are welcome; an appointment is recommended.

Open year-round. Public bus stop at our doorstep. Tour buses accommodated.
